The Strategic Evolution of Healthcare Technology Management
The Certified Healthcare Technology Manager (CHTM) credential represents the pinnacle of professional achievement for leaders in the Healthcare Technology Management (HTM) field. Administered by the AAMI Credentials Institute (ACI), this certification is not merely a test of technical knowledge; it is a rigorous assessment of a professional's ability to manage the complex intersection of technology, finance, personnel, and patient safety. As healthcare systems become increasingly reliant on sophisticated medical device networks and integrated data, the role of the HTM manager has evolved from a 'head technician' to a strategic executive partner.
Earning the CHTM designation signals to employers that a candidate possesses the business acumen required to oversee multi-million dollar budgets, lead diverse teams of biomedical equipment technicians (BMETs), and navigate the labyrinth of healthcare regulations. For those looking to move into Director or Vice President roles within clinical engineering, the CHTM is often a prerequisite or a significant competitive advantage.
Who Should Pursue the CHTM?
The CHTM is designed for professionals who have already established a foundation in healthcare technology and are now operating in, or aspiring to, management roles. This includes:
- Biomedical Managers and Directors: Current leaders who want to validate their expertise and stay current with industry standards.
- Aspiring HTM Leaders: Senior technicians or clinical engineers looking to transition into supervisory or administrative positions.
- Military HTM Personnel: Individuals transitioning from military medical logistics and maintenance roles into civilian healthcare leadership.
- Clinical Engineers: Professionals who bridge the gap between engineering design and hospital operations.
While technical certifications like the CBET focus on the 'how' of equipment repair, the CHTM focuses on the 'why' and 'how much' of departmental operations. If your daily tasks involve more spreadsheets, policy writing, and personnel meetings than soldering irons and multimeters, the CHTM is the logical next step in your career path.
Eligibility and Prerequisites
The ACI maintains strict eligibility requirements to ensure that only those with a baseline of practical management experience can sit for the exam. Candidates must meet one of the following pathways:
| Pathway | Education Requirement | Experience Requirement |
|---|---|---|
| Option 1 | Bachelor's degree in a relevant field (e.g., Engineering, Business, Healthcare Admin) | 3 years of HTM management experience |
| Option 2 | Associate degree or military training in HTM/BMET | 5 years of HTM management experience |
| Option 3 | Current CBET, CRES, or CLES certification | 3 years of HTM management experience |
| Option 4 | High School Diploma or equivalent | 10 years of HTM management experience |
It is important to note that 'management experience' is defined by the ACI as having responsibility for personnel, budgets, and departmental operations. Simply being a 'lead tech' without administrative authority may not satisfy the requirement. Candidates are encouraged to verify their specific situation with the ACI before applying.
The CHTM Exam Blueprint: Five Pillars of Knowledge
The CHTM exam is structured around five core domains. Understanding the weight of each domain is critical for prioritizing your study time. Unlike technical exams, the CHTM requires a deep understanding of organizational behavior and financial principles.
1. Financial Management (25%)
This is often the most challenging section for candidates coming from a purely technical background. It covers the lifecycle of medical equipment from a fiscal perspective. Key topics include:
- Capital Planning: Developing multi-year plans for equipment replacement based on clinical need, technology life cycles, and financial constraints.
- Operating Budgets: Managing day-to-day expenses, including service contracts, parts, and labor costs.
- Total Cost of Ownership (TCO): Calculating the full cost of a device over its lifespan, including maintenance, utilities, and disposal.
- Return on Investment (ROI): Justifying new technology purchases by demonstrating financial or clinical gains.
2. Operations Management (25%)
Operations management focuses on the efficiency and effectiveness of the HTM department. Candidates must demonstrate proficiency in:
- Service Delivery Models: Deciding between in-house repair, manufacturer service contracts, or third-party independent service organizations (ISOs).
- Computerized Maintenance Management Systems (CMMS): Utilizing data from CMMS to track KPIs, such as Mean Time to Repair (MTTR) and scheduled maintenance completion rates.
- Inventory Management: Maintaining accurate records of all medical devices, including their location, status, and service history.
3. Education and Training (10%)
A manager must ensure that both their staff and the clinical users of equipment are properly trained. This domain covers:
- Staff Development: Identifying skill gaps in the HTM team and providing opportunities for technical and leadership training.
- User Training: Collaborating with clinical staff to reduce operator errors, which are a leading cause of equipment 'malfunctions.'
- Competency Assessment: Implementing formal processes to verify that technicians are qualified to work on specific high-risk devices.
4. Personnel Management (20%)
Leading a team requires a different skill set than fixing a ventilator. This domain tests your knowledge of:
- Hiring and Retention: Writing job descriptions, interviewing candidates, and creating a culture that retains top talent in a competitive market.
- Performance Management: Conducting annual reviews, setting goals, and managing disciplinary actions when necessary.
- Labor Laws: Understanding basic HR principles, including FMLA, ADA, and Fair Labor Standards Act (FLSA) as they apply to a technical workforce.
5. Risk Management (20%)
In the healthcare environment, risk management is synonymous with patient safety and regulatory compliance. This section is critical and covers:
- Regulatory Compliance: Deep knowledge of The Joint Commission (TJC), DNV, and CMS standards for medical equipment.
- Cybersecurity: Managing the risks associated with networked medical devices and protecting patient data (HIPAA).
- Incident Investigation: Leading the root cause analysis (RCA) when a medical device is involved in a patient injury or death (SMDA reporting).
- Alternative Equipment Maintenance (AEM): Understanding the strict requirements for deviating from manufacturer-recommended maintenance schedules.
Difficulty Analysis and the Managerial Mindset
The CHTM is categorized as an Advanced level certification. The difficulty does not stem from complex engineering formulas, but from the ambiguity of management. In a technical exam, there is usually one 'right' way to calibrate a device. In a management exam, you must choose the 'best' course of action among several plausible options based on organizational goals and safety regulations.
Candidates often fail because they answer questions as a technician. For example, if a question asks how to handle a recurring failure in a fleet of infusion pumps, a technician might look for the technical fix. A manager, however, must look at the data trends, consider a recall notification, evaluate the impact on clinical workflow, and perhaps initiate a capital replacement project. Shifting your perspective is the most important part of your preparation.
Study Strategy: The 53-Hour Plan
To master the CHTM, a structured approach is required. We recommend a 53-hour study plan spread over 8 to 10 weeks. This allows for deep immersion into the topics without burnout.
- Phase 1: Foundation (Hours 1-10): Read the AAMI CHTM Handbook cover to cover. Familiarize yourself with the terminology and the specific way AAMI defines management roles.
- Phase 2: Financial and Operations Deep Dive (Hours 11-25): Focus on the heavy hitters. Practice calculating depreciation, ROI, and analyzing CMMS reports. If you don't have access to your facility's budget, ask your director for a redacted version to study.
- Phase 3: Regulatory and Risk (Hours 26-40): Study the latest Joint Commission Environment of Care (EC) standards. Understand the difference between 'critical' and 'non-critical' equipment and the rules governing AEM programs. Review the Certified Healthcare Facility Manager (CHFM) concepts if you work closely with facilities, as there is significant overlap in safety standards.
- Phase 4: Personnel and IT Integration (Hours 41-48): Review basic HR management principles. Spend time understanding medical device security and how it aligns with the CAHIMS framework for healthcare information systems.
- Phase 5: Final Review and Practice (Hours 49-53): Take timed practice exams to build stamina. Focus on your weakest domains and review the rationale for every wrong answer.

Exam Day Logistics
The CHTM exam is administered via computer at PSI testing centers. Here is what to expect:
- Arrival: Arrive at least 30 minutes early. You will need to provide two forms of valid identification.
- Environment: The testing center is proctored and monitored. You will likely be in a room with people taking various other professional exams.
- Materials: You are generally not allowed to bring anything into the testing room. An on-screen calculator is usually provided for financial questions.
- Results: In most cases, you will receive a preliminary 'pass/fail' notification immediately upon completion, with official results following by mail or email.
Common Mistakes to Avoid
'The biggest mistake I see is candidates over-studying the technical aspects and under-studying the financial and personnel aspects. You aren't being tested on how to fix a heart monitor; you're being tested on how to manage the department that fixes the heart monitor.'
- Ignoring the 'Managerial' Context: Always ask yourself, 'What would a Director do?' rather than 'What would a Technician do?'
- Underestimating the Financial Section: Many HTM professionals have never had to manage a budget. If this is you, spend extra time on accounting basics and capital equipment procurement.
- Neglecting Regulatory Updates: Standards from The Joint Commission and CMS change frequently. Ensure you are studying the most current versions of the Environment of Care standards.
- Poor Time Management: With 100 questions in 120 minutes, you have just over a minute per question. Don't get bogged down in a single difficult financial calculation; flag it and move on.

Renewal and Continuing Education
The CHTM credential is valid for a three-year period. To maintain certification, you must complete 30 continuing education units (CEUs) during each three-year cycle. These units can be earned through:
- Attending industry conferences (like the AAMI Exchange).
- Completing relevant college courses or professional seminars.
- Publishing articles in HTM journals.
- Participating in professional leadership roles or mentoring.
Maintaining your certification ensures that you stay at the forefront of a rapidly changing field, particularly as issues like AI in medical devices and advanced cybersecurity threats become more prevalent.
